RSA Archer vs Canarie
RSA Archer is an enterprise GRC platform used by large organizations for risk management, compliance, and audit. Canarie is a compliance execution platform purpose-built for financial institutions. Archer provides enterprise GRC capabilities; Canarie provides operational compliance with fast deployment.
Quick comparison
| Area | RSA Archer | Canarie |
|---|---|---|
| Market position | Enterprise GRC platform | Financial compliance execution |
| Implementation | 12-24 months typical | 30-45 days |
| Customization | Highly customizable (required) | Pre-built for financial compliance |
| Target organization | Large enterprises | Financial institutions (all sizes) |
| Total cost | High (software + implementation) | Predictable subscription |
| Day-to-day usability | Challenging for operators | Built for daily compliance work |
